diff options
author | Andrew Marshall <andrew@johnandrewmarshall.com> | 2022-02-14 19:08:11 -0500 |
---|---|---|
committer | Andrew Marshall <andrew@johnandrewmarshall.com> | 2022-02-16 01:22:19 -0500 |
commit | a6b058e0fac70144041029ba3e2de7e44efcecba (patch) | |
tree | 020f65f372f1d95fb1d64a67848fff460e96941a /pkgs/applications/virtualization | |
parent | c027cb0041ddbc73cc3e9894b97073c1cd6a9483 (diff) | |
download | n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.tar n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.tar.gz n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.tar.bz2 n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.tar.lz n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.tar.xz n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.tar.zst nixlib-a6b058e0fac70144041029ba3e2de7e44efcecba.zip |
virt-viewer: 9.0 -> 11.0
Diffstat (limited to 'pkgs/applications/virtualization')
-rw-r--r-- | pkgs/applications/virtualization/virt-viewer/default.nix | 21 |
1 files changed, 17 insertions, 4 deletions
diff --git a/pkgs/applications/virtualization/virt-viewer/default.nix b/pkgs/applications/virtualization/virt-viewer/default.nix index a7f9c4c37639..29e05a069ce7 100644 --- a/pkgs/applications/virtualization/virt-viewer/default.nix +++ b/pkgs/applications/virtualization/virt-viewer/default.nix @@ -1,5 +1,6 @@ { lib , stdenv +, bash-completion , fetchurl , gdbm ? null , glib @@ -8,10 +9,14 @@ , gtk3 , intltool , libcap ? null +, libgovirt , libvirt , libvirt-glib , libxml2 +, meson +, ninja , pkg-config +, python3 , shared-mime-info , spice-gtk ? null , spice-protocol ? null @@ -31,27 +36,32 @@ with lib; stdenv.mkDerivation rec { baseName = "virt-viewer"; - version = "9.0"; + version = "11.0"; name = "${baseName}-${version}"; src = fetchurl { - url = "http://virt-manager.org/download/sources/${baseName}/${name}.tar.gz"; - sha256 = "09a83mzyn3b4nd7wpa659g1zf1fjbzb79rk968bz6k5xl21k7d4i"; + url = "http://virt-manager.org/download/sources/${baseName}/${name}.tar.xz"; + sha256 = "sha256-pD+iMlxMHHelyMmAZaww7wURohrJjlkPIjQIabrZq9A="; }; nativeBuildInputs = [ glib intltool + meson + ninja pkg-config + python3 shared-mime-info wrapGAppsHook ]; buildInputs = [ + bash-completion glib gsettings-desktop-schemas gtk-vnc gtk3 + libgovirt libvirt libvirt-glib libxml2 @@ -67,7 +77,10 @@ stdenv.mkDerivation rec { propagatedUserEnvPkgs = optional spiceSupport spice-gtk; strictDeps = true; - enableParallelBuilding = true; + + postPatch = '' + patchShebangs build-aux/post_install.py + ''; meta = { description = "A viewer for remote virtual machines"; |